740.00119 Control (Korea)/8–1947: Telegram

The Acting Secretary of State to the Political Adviser in Korea (Jacobs)

secret

176. Urtel 284 Aug 19. Dept does not believe USdel should propose recess of Joint Commission pending reply from Soviet Govt to our proposal being sent Aug 25 to London, Nanking and Moscow for Four Power conversations on Korea. Text of this proposal (Appendix D SWNCC 176/30) has been slightly revised and will be forwarded separately to you.

[Page 762]

You should not initiate further discussions. If Soviet Delegation makes proposals of entirely new character you should refer them to Washington for instructions with your recommendations. If Soviets suddenly accept your proposals made at 53rd meeting Joint Commission or submit counter proposals along those lines you should state that in view of fact these counter proposals received after Aug 21 deadline they must be referred to Washington for instructions. In referring these proposals your recommendations should be included.

Lovett
